Interactive Features of Augmented Reality in Cricket

Augmented reality has revolutionized the way fans experience cricket matches, offering a more interactive and immersive viewing experience. Through the use of AR technology, cricket enthusiasts can now enjoy real-time statistics, player information, and live replays overlaid onto their screens as they watch the game unfold. This new dimension of interactivity not only enhances the fan experience but also provides valuable insights and analysis, making it easier for viewers to understand the game on a deeper level.

Furthermore, augmented reality in cricket introduces interactive features such as virtual player comparisons, pitch analysis, and 3D visualizations of gameplay strategies. Fans can now delve into the intricacies of the sport like never before, gaining a better appreciation for the skills and tactics involved in every play.
